Stage 2: Workflow Selection (1 minute)
Question: "Which workflow approach fits your project?"
Option 1: Event Modeling (Recommended for complex domains)
Best for:
- •Event-sourced systems
- •Complex business logic with multiple bounded contexts
- •Domain-driven design approach
- •Teams that benefit from upfront domain modeling
Workflow: Discovery → Design → GWT → Tasks → TDD → PR
Time investment: 2-4 hours upfront design, faster implementation
Option 2: Traditional (Recommended for CRUD/simple features)
Best for:
- •CRUD applications
- •Simple feature work
- •Well-understood domains
- •Microservices with clear boundaries
Workflow: Issues → TDD → PR
Time investment: Minimal upfront, may need refactoring later

Stage 3: Advanced Options (1 minute, optional)
You can skip this stage - defaults work great for most projects.
Question 1: Git Worktrees?
Yes (Recommended for parallel work):
- •Each task gets isolated directory
- •Switch tasks without stashing
- •Clean separation, no conflicts
No (Standard branch workflow):
- •Work in single repo directory
- •Use
git checkoutto switch - •Simpler mental model
Question 2: Stacked PRs (git-spice)?
Yes (Recommended for incremental changes):
- •Break large features into reviewable slices
- •Each slice = separate PR
- •Automatic dependency management
No (One PR per feature):
- •Standard GitHub workflow
- •Simpler review process
Question 3: GitHub Repository Setup?
Yes (Recommended for team workflows):
- •Configure repository rulesets (branch protection)
- •Set up automatic PR branch deletion
- •Configure default PR title/message templates
- •Set allowed merge types (squash/merge/rebase)
No (Skip repository configuration):
- •Use default GitHub settings
- •Configure manually later

4.5. Tool Detection (Advanced Stage)
When git-spice is selected in advanced options, verify installation:
# Check if gs command exists if command -v gs >/dev/null 2>&1; then echo "✓ git-spice (gs) installed" else echo "⚠️ git-spice not found" echo "Installation: https://abhinav.github.io/git-spice/" echo "Note: The CLI command is 'gs', not 'git-spice'" fi
Important: Check for the gs command, NOT git-spice.
